Sound card problem

I am having problems with my sound. The sound is all distorbed when i want to do something else, such as opening a program. I don't know if there is a IRQ problem which i don't think so. I tried looking in the device manager, but everything seems ok. First i had the same problem with a soundcard inboard in my motherboard (K7S5A Pro). but i said maybe it doesn't work, so i bought a new sound card and i still have the same problem. I have Windows Xp, 256MB ram, 1.2Ghz Amd Atlon. The only thing i see is that irq 10 is shared by the sound card and Usb 2.0 host controller. I looked at their properties but there is no conflict.
